Silent No More: watchOS 11.4 Introduces 'Break Through Silent Mode' and Enhanced Matter Support
New 'Break Through Silent Mode' in watchOS 11.4 Apple has released watchOS 11.4, which introduces the new 'Break Through Silent Mode' feature under Sound & Haptics. This allows sound and haptics to play even when Silent Mode is enabled, making it useful for alarms or notifications during sleep.
Matter Support for Robotic Vacuums and Mops
The update also adds Matter support, enabling users to control robotic vacuums and mops with their voice, including commands to start or stop cleaning, return to the dock, enable or disable mopping functions, and switch cleaning modes.

How to Update to watchOS 11.4
- On Apple Watch: Open Settings > General > Software Update > Install.
- Via iPhone: Open the Apple Watch app > General > Software Update > Download > Follow on-screen instructions.
